Intensify Fight Against Malnutrition – Akyeampong

Accra,(Greater Accra) 4 Nov. A three-day international workshop on incorporating nutrition considerations into agricultural research plans and programmes today opened in Accra with a call for multi- disciplinary collaboration in the fight against malnutrition in the developing world. The Deputy Minister of Food and Agriculture, Mr. Mike K. Akyeampong, said the fight against malnutrition and food insecurity in the developing world ”calls for a multi-disciplinary coordination and collaboration”. All policy makers, agricultural researchers, nutrition workers, farmers and consumers need to be involved and committed to this objective. The workshop is organized by the United Nations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) to provide governments and agricultural research institutions with guidelines to incorporate nutrition in the planning and implementation of research and development activities. Some 30 participants from 11 countries and bilateral and multi- lateral organizations are attending the workshop.
